Factory Reset Methods for TWS Earbuds
There are several ways to factory reset TWS earbuds, and the method you choose will depend on the specific model and brand of your earbuds. In this section, we will cover the most common factory reset methods for TWS earbuds.
Method 1: Button Combination Reset
This is the most common method for factory resetting TWS earbuds. To perform a button combination reset, follow these steps:
- Make sure the earbuds are turned off.
- Press and hold the charging case button and the earbud button simultaneously for 10-15 seconds.
- Release the buttons when the LED lights on the earbuds and charging case start flashing.
- Wait for 30 seconds to allow the earbuds to complete the reset process.
Note: The exact button combination may vary depending on the brand and model of your earbuds. Check your user manual or manufacturer’s website for specific instructions.
Method 2: Reset through the Companion App
Some TWS earbuds come with a companion app that allows you to reset the earbuds remotely. To reset your earbuds through the app, follow these steps:
- Open the companion app on your smartphone.
- Go to the settings or preferences section.
- Look for the “Reset” or “Factory Reset” option and select it.
- Confirm that you want to reset the earbuds.
- Wait for the app to complete the reset process.
Note: Not all TWS earbuds have a companion app, and not all apps offer a reset feature. Check your user manual or manufacturer’s website for specific instructions.
Method 3: Reset through the Charging Case
Some TWS earbuds can be reset through the charging case. To reset your earbuds through the charging case, follow these steps:
- Place the earbuds in the charging case.
- Close the charging case lid.
- Press and hold the charging case button for 10-15 seconds.
- Release the button when the LED lights on the charging case start flashing.
- Wait for 30 seconds to allow the earbuds to complete the reset process.
Note: This method may not work for all TWS earbuds, and the exact steps may vary depending on the brand and model of your earbuds. Check your user manual or manufacturer’s website for specific instructions.
Troubleshooting Common Issues after Factory Reset
After factory resetting your TWS earbuds, you may encounter some common issues. In this section, we will cover some troubleshooting tips to help you resolve these issues.
Issue 1: Earbuds Not Pairing with Device
If your earbuds are not pairing with your device after a factory reset, try the following:
- Make sure the earbuds are turned off and the charging case is closed.
- Open the Bluetooth settings on your device and forget the earbuds.
- Turn on the earbuds and put them in pairing mode.
- Search for the earbuds on your device and select them to pair.
Issue 2: Earbuds Not Connecting to Each Other
If your earbuds are not connecting to each other after a factory reset, try the following:
- Make sure the earbuds are turned off and the charging case is closed.
- Open the charging case and place the earbuds in it.
- Close the charging case lid and wait for 10 seconds.
- Open the charging case and take out the earbuds.
- Try pairing the earbuds again.
Issue 3: Earbuds Not Responding to Voice Commands
If your earbuds are not responding to voice commands after a factory reset, try the following:
- Make sure the earbuds are connected to your device and the voice assistant is enabled.
- Check the voice assistant settings to ensure the earbuds are set as the default audio device.
- Try resetting the voice assistant on your device.
By following these troubleshooting tips, you should be able to resolve common issues that may arise after factory resetting your TWS earbuds.

How do I factory reset my TWS earbuds?
To factory reset your TWS earbuds, start by putting them in their charging case. Locate the small reset button, usually found on the bottom or side of the case. Press and hold the reset button for 5-10 seconds, until the earbuds’ lights flash or you hear a voice prompt indicating the reset process has begun. Release the button and let the earbuds complete the reset process, which may take a few minutes. Once the reset is complete, your earbuds will be restored to their original settings, and you can start the pairing process again with your device.

How do I start the pairing process again after a factory reset?
After a factory reset, your TWS earbuds will be restored to their original settings, and you’ll need to start the pairing process again with your device. To do this, put the earbuds in their charging case and open the lid. The earbuds should automatically enter pairing mode, indicated by flashing lights or a voice prompt. On your device, go to the Bluetooth settings and search for available devices. Select your earbuds from the list, and follow the prompts to complete the pairing process. Once paired, you can start using your earbuds again, and customize the settings to your liking.
